1 additional project is a component of the Expression profiling and H3K4me3 occupancy in WT and jhd2Δ Saccharomyces cerevisiae cells.
We describe the landscape of H3K4me3 in WT and jhd2Δ cells in YAR media by ChIP seq
Overall design: To determine the contribution of Jhd2 to the H3K4me3 landscape in respiring yeast cells, we performed H3K4me3 ChIP and normalized to pan-H3 ChIP signal.
